A new monthly deal scheme promises to ‘offer a huge saving’ on the latest tech to anyone in the UK.
Daily Express :: Tech Feed
A new monthly deal scheme promises to ‘offer a huge saving’ on the latest tech to anyone in the UK.
Daily Express :: Tech Feed